Andrea Bocelli recently made headlines with two remarkable concerts. On Saturday, September 6, he and his son Matteo performed “Dolce è Sentire” for Pope Leo XIV. This event celebrated the opening of the Laudato Si’ Village, a special place focused on education, ecology, and fraternity.
Just a week later, on September 13, Bocelli returned to the Vatican for another performance. This concert marked the end of the third World Meeting on Human Fraternity and kicked off the celebration for the 2025 Jubilee Year. Co-directed by Pharrell Williams and Bocelli, it was the first public concert ever held in St. Peter’s Square.
During the event, Bocelli and KAROL G sang “Vivo Por Ella” together for the first time. The lineup also featured Pharrell with the Voices of Fire Gospel Choir, John Legend, Jennifer Hudson, Clipse, Teddy Swims, Jelly Roll, Angélique Kidjo, and more.
A stunning aerial drone and light show by Nova Sky Stories lit up the night sky, showcasing images inspired by the Sistine Chapel. The drones created visuals of the late Pope Francis, the Virgin Mary, doves, and Michelangelo’s creation of Adam above St. Peter’s Basilica.
The concert was streamed live worldwide on Disney+, Hulu, and ABC News Live. Pharrell opened the show with heartfelt remarks, thanking Pope Leo XIV for welcoming everyone to this sacred space. He emphasized the importance of unity and compassion among all people, regardless of their backgrounds.
